Summary

What is the great white throne of judgement and why does it matter to us? Emma Dotter meets us in Revelation 20 to answer these questions. We leave today's episode motivated to live a life that is pleasing to God. We are encouraged by the reality that we are saved by grace alone, faith alone, and justice on all sinfulness and brokenness is coming.


Today's challenge: Think about how you will stand before God for your life and let that truth saturate into all that you do today.
